GENERAL

Power requirement

: AC 120 V`, 60 Hz

Power consumption

 

Power on

: 22 W

Power off

: 3 W

Temperature

 

Operating

: 5°C to 40°C (41°F to 104°F)

Storage

: –20°C to 60°C (–4°F to140°F)

Operating position

: Horizontal only

Dimensions (W x H x D) : 400 x 94 x 273 mm (15-3/4" x 3-3/4" x 10-3/4")

: 3.1 kg (6.9 lbs)
